  • Patent number: 11610222
    Abstract: Leads may be generated for content sponsors based on expressions of interest by users, the users being users of an online system. These leads typically require time or expense from a sponsor to follow up on the lead. The online system scores leads for sponsors to prioritize responding to the generated leads. The scores may include a purchase capacity score and a purchase intent score. The purchase capacity score estimates a user's ability to spend an amount specified by the sponsor for the product, and the purchase intent score estimates a user's likelihood to convert or be interested in the sponsor's product. The scores may be combined to provide a single lead quality score for a user that obscures the source of the online system's prediction to the sponsor.

  • Patent number: 11379861
    Abstract: A method is disclosed which includes: receiving, from a third-party content provider, a link to a structured document on an external server, where the link is associated with a post of the online social network by the third-party content provider, and retrieving the structured document from the external server, where the structured document includes content and input fields. This step is followed by extracting a predefined set of information from the structured document about the content and input fields of the structured document. The extracted set of information from the structured document are then evaluated to determine one or more feature-values of the structured document. A machine learning model is used to classify the structured document as an external lead-generation type page based on the one or more feature-values of the structured document and a notification is sent to the third-party content provider if the structured document is classified as an external lead-generation type page.

  • Publication number: 20180341999
    Abstract: An online system acts as a centralized, trusted intermediary in managing subscription products that a user of the online system has subscribed to. For example, a user may subscribe to receive a product from a variety of different third party systems. The user of the online system provides payment information and authorization information to the online system which stores them in association with a user profile belonging to the user of the online system. When a payment is required for a subscription product, the online system retrieves the payment information and verifies that the online system is authorized to provide a payment. Once verified, the online system provides a payment on behalf of the user to the third party system in exchange for provision of the subscription product to the user.
